Output 2531cd32a40d9fe5efcbea3f818e9e96eacc0d74e86ef481a38ec77d8a0b68b2:0

value
417682000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fccdb5bb606f005094254013eb0d69ecb1e210a9 OP_EQUAL
address
3QjidrmBHFDu9Z6VAEKdFmdQYyKSLBQ4r4
transaction
2531cd32a40d9fe5efcbea3f818e9e96eacc0d74e86ef481a38ec77d8a0b68b2
confirmations
245729
spent
true